Is The Gre Curved?

Is the GRE Test Graded on a Curve? GRE score is not curved, and scores for the Quantitative and Verbal section fall in different percentiles. For instance, a score of 165 in the Verbal section might have you in the 96th percentile, but the same score will only get you […]

Is Scheller Mba Stem Certified?

Is the Scheller MBA STEM-designated? Effective May 31, 2022, the MBA program is recognized as a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ics (STEM) degree. International students graduating with an MBA degree after this date will be eligible to apply for a two-year Optional Practical Training (OPT) extension. Is Scheller a good […]
